Regional Disaster Management Agency of North Sumatra Province (BPBD), Indonesia

 

Description

Regional Disaster Management Agency of North Sumatra Province -Indonesia is a work unit of the North Sumatra Provincial Government that manages disaster management and risk reduction services that have an impact on strengthening the environment for inclusive economic welfare. Through the Vision \\\"North Sumatra Collaboration: Blessings Towards a Superior, Advanced, and Sustainable North Sumatra,\\\"which translates into the following missions: Improving Human Resources Quality, Maintaining Macroeconomic Stability, Improving Governance Quality, Developing and Arranging Quality, Aesthetic, and Environmentally Friendly Infrastructure, Strengthening Social and Cultural Resilience to Build a Resilient North Sumatra Community. As a Disaster Analyst, the interventions carried out focus on strengthening communities in disaster management and risk reduction based on local wisdom diversity through environmental hub solutions that are able to improve the economic welfare of the community inclusively through disaster-responsible sub-district communities (KENCANA), disaster-resilient villages (DESTANA), disaster-resilient villages (KELTANA), disaster-safe educational units (SPAB), disaster-safe madrasah-pesantren units (SMAB), disaster-resilient families (KATANA), disaster-resilient women (WATANA). All of which are pillars and capital for building a disaster-aware culture based on environmental hub solutions that improve economic welfare in 6,113 villages/sub-districts.
